Let's settle an argument here, when paying compliments to warrant officers?
I have always braced up and addressed them as sir or ma'am, never saluted though. That has always done the job. My friend however insists warrant officers must be saluted?
I'm fairly certain I'm right. Please put this other young upstart in his place.

No. Commissions are saluted.

Only those who hold a commission from the Queen are saluted, now a RSM may like to be saluted but in all the regiments I have been in it is just a sir and a snap to attention if that is what he wants
